希赛考试网
首页 > 软考 > 网络工程师

stp配置边缘端口

希赛网 2024-06-20 08:37:13

边缘端口是交换机上连接到终端设备的端口。在网络拓扑中,其作用是连接主机、服务器、打印机、路由器等终端设备。STP(Spanning Tree Protocol)则是一种在环形拓扑结构中消除环路的协议。本文将从什么是STP、为什么需要STP、STP的工作原理、如何配置边缘端口等多个角度进行分析。

什么是STP?

STP是一种在交换机之间和交换机内部消除环路的协议,它可以在交换机之间发现环路并选择合适的端口进行屏蔽。STP是IEEE 802.1D标准中的一部分,有一些变种如RSTP(Rapid Spanning Tree Protocol)和MSTP(Multiple Spanning Tree Protocol)。

为什么需要STP?

网络拓扑中存在环路会导致数据包循环转发,消耗网络带宽,导致网络拥堵,降低网络性能。而STP则可以通过选举根交换机、选择合适端口进行屏蔽等方式避免这种现象。STP还可以提高网络的可靠性,因为当交换机某个接口失效或者故障时,其他交换机会重新计算拓扑结构,找到另外的可用路径。

STP的工作原理

STP的工作原理在于决定哪些交换机的端口要被屏蔽。首先,交换机要选举一个根交换机,然后根据每个交换机到根交换机路径成本决定端口的状态。根据STP计算控制器计算出的最短路径,桥接的端口被开启,提供链路转发服务,非桥接的端口被禁止。

如何配置边缘端口?

边缘端口是指那些连接到终端设备的交换机端口。由于这些端口连接设备的网络拓扑是没有环形结构的,所以将这些端口配置为STP的边缘端口就可以避免不必要的拓扑计算,提高网络性能。

方法一:手动配置

可以手动将交换机的某些端口配置为边缘端口,防止其被误认为交换机端口连接到了网络互连设备。应该使用以下命令将交换机端口配置为边缘端口:

Switch(config)# interface fa0/1

Switch(config-if)# spanning-tree portfast

Switch(config-if)# spanning-tree bpduguard enable

方法二:自动配置

此外也可以使用BPDU接受守护程序自动向交换机端口断开BPDU流量。在这种情况下,端口也可以被认为是边缘端口。这种方法对于那些需要频繁连接和断开设备的场景非常适用。

在这种情况下,可以使用以下命令将交换机端口配置为边缘端口:

Switch(config)# spanning-tree portfast bpduguard default

Switch(config-if)# spanning-tree portfast

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件